使用代码分析来分析托管代码质量

您可以在 Visual Studio 中使用代码分析工具发现代码中的潜在问题,如不安全的数据访问、使用冲突和设计问题。代码分析可处理 .NET Framework、本机(C 和 C++)和数据库应用程序。针对托管代码的代码分析在以特定编码问题为目标的规则集中组织各种规则。

常规任务

常规任务

支持内容

亲身实践:通过更正简单 .NET Framework 应用程序中的缺陷,了解代码分析的基本知识。

为项目配置代码分析:托管代码的各种规则组织为以特定领域(如安全和设计)为目标的规则集。可以使用某个 Microsoft 标准规则集或创建自己的规则集。

运行代码分析:可以指定在每次生成项目配置时自动运行代码分析,也可以手动对项目运行代码分析。

分析代码分析结果: “错误列表”窗口下列出了代码分析产生的警告和错误。可以选择警告或错误标题显示有关该警告的附加信息同时显示并高亮所符合的源代码行。可以选择警告 ID 显示 MSDN 中包含解决问题的信息和示例的详细信息。

将代码分析与开发生命周期集成在一起:利用 Team Foundation 版本控制中的签入策略,开发团队可以确保所有代码签入都符合一组常用的代码分析标准。为代码分析规则冲突创建工作项是一个可在“错误列表”窗口中执行的简单过程。